The Importance of Emergency Boarding Up


Emergency boarding up serves a number of vital functions:

  1. Prevent Further Damage: After a catastrophe, open windows and doors produce vulnerabilities that can cause water damage, theft, or vandalism. Boarding up these openings is important to avoid additional losses.

  2. Security: Boarded-up homes are less attractive to potential robbers. This added layer of protection can deter criminal activity throughout the vulnerable period following a disaster.

  3. Insurance coverage Compliance: Many insurance coverage service providers require property owners to take immediate steps to secure their property after a loss. Boarding up can often be a requirement for submitting claims successfully with insurance companies.

  4. Security: In the case of broken glass or unsteady structures, boarding up guarantees that people can not unintentionally injure themselves on the property.

  5. Area Integrity: An unboarded property can interfere with community looks and safety. Appropriately securing the building helps maintain community values.

The Process of Emergency Boarding Up


The boarding-up process includes several essential actions:

  1. Assess the Damage: Before any boarding up can start, assess the level and location of the damage. Identify which doors and windows require boarding and guarantee that no individuals are caught inside.

  2. Gather Materials: The most typical materials for boarding up include plywood sheets, screws, nails, and protective gear. Local hardware stores typically carry these materials.

  3. Step and Cut: Carefully determine the openings to be covered. Cut the plywood sheets to fit safely over each opening. A snug fit is very important to ensure they remain in location.

  4. Secure the Boards: Fasten the cut plywood sheets over the openings utilizing screws or sturdy nails. Ensure that the boards are well-secured to withstand wind, further damage, or attempted break-ins.

  5. Examine for Future Repairs: Once the property is protected, prepare for repairs. Speak with local contractors to obtain estimates for restoring the property to its initial condition.
